The Perpetual Motion Roadshow is an indie press tour circuit with monthly stops in Toronto, Montreal, Boston, Brooklyn, Cleveland, Cincinnati and Chicago. Seven shows in seven days.

m@b will be on the road to promote WIDE COLLAR CRIMES, a collection of m@b issues from 2000-2002.

My traveling partners will be Emily Pohl-Weary (editor of the literary magazine Kiss Machine) and Bill Brown (a Chicago-based author of truck stop coffee and boxcar graffiti).

A group of three have already completed the April circuit. For more info on the tour or to listen to telephone diaries go to NoMediaKings.net. I'm part of the May touring crew, with another three indie press stars pounding the pavement in June.
